Silver and white enamel Maltese cross with ball tipped finials, a gilt, green and amber enamel wreath of oak and laurel between the arms, on crossed swords and swivel crown suspension; the face with a circular central black enamel medallion with the gilt lion rampant of Belgium encircled by a red enamel ring inscribed with the Belgian motto Belgian motto ‘L’UNION FAIT LA FORCE’ (Strength through Unity) within a beaded border; the reverse with a central black enamel medallion with the monogrammed gilt letters ‘LR’ for ‘Leopold Rex’ within a red enamel ring decorated with stylised lilies within a beaded border; loss of enamel from the tips of the left, right and lower arms, some old minor repairs (see illustrations); on replaced correct ribbon. The Order of Leopold is both the oldest Belgian order, having been created in 1832, and the most senior. The order is awarded for long and distinguished service or for notable achievement. Insignia of the Order after 1951 bear the Belgian motto in both French and Flemish. A good quality older example.
